What is Web Hosting
Web hosting is a rental service that we use to store our important files like images, videos, PDF files, audio files, text etc. and other data. We can access all these files with the help of a website or web application as well as give them online access for the public as well.
In other words, web hosting is an online service that helps to put our website or web application online over the internet. How Web Hosting Works
The server on which you host your website or web application is a physical computer that is constantly running and keeps your website online for visitors to the Internet.
When a user accesses your website by typing your domain name in the address bar of the browser or searches your website through a search engine. The web host's server then displays all the necessary files in the browser to load your website.
You can self-host your website or web application if you wish, but for this you need extensive technical knowledge. Like software setup for hosting, hardware setup etc.
But when you buy hosting from a hosting provider, that company makes sure that your website performs with better security protocols. Along with this, the work of simplifying the difficult aspects like software installation, removing errors etc are also included. The best part is that whenever you face any problem with hosting, these companies also provide you technical support.

Shared Hosting
In simple words, When multiple websites of many clients are hosted on the same server, then it is called shared hosting.
Shared hosting is the most used service in the world. Because shared hosting is the cheapest and does not require much technical knowledge. VPS Hosting ( Virtual Private Server )
VPS hosting or virtual private servers are those that are allocated virtually in a dedicated server. They work almost like dedicated servers because virtually all resources are dedicated to them. RAM, storage and CPU cores are allocated virtually.
VPS hosting is a bit expensive compared to shared hosting. But it is cheaper than Dedicated Hosting.
Dedicated Hosting ( Dedicated Server )
When a company or person rents an entire server for hosting, then it is called Dedicated Hosting. As the name suggests, Dedicated.
Dedicated hosting is expensive compared to shared hosting and VPS hosting. Dedicated hosting is mostly used by big companies for their high traffic website or application. But it is not that small companies or individuals do not use dedicated hosting.
In Dedicated Hosting, company or a person rent an entire server. Servers come with different configurations, so companies or individuals rent according to their needs.
